Toncoin (TON)
Originally developed by the Telegram team, Toncoin operates on The Open Network blockchain. The platform emphasizes scalability, speed, and user-friendly integration to support a decentralized internet. Its connection to Telegram's extensive user base provides substantial adoption potential. The network hosts numerous decentralized applications while maintaining security and efficiency.
TON's development roadmap focuses on ecosystem expansion and leveraging Telegram's widespread reach.

Polkadot (DOT)
This network addresses blockchain interoperability through innovative parachain technology, enabling different networks to communicate and share information. The architecture enhances scalability while maintaining security standards. Multiple projects building on Polkadot's framework contribute to ecosystem expansion.
The platform's unique approach to cross-chain functionality creates substantial utility value.
Avalanche (AVAX)
Designed for high scalability and decentralized asset transfer, Avalanche features a unique consensus mechanism enabling high throughput with low latency. The platform's subnet architecture allows custom blockchain creation, expanding its utility across DeFi and NFT sectors. Growing developer adoption reflects the network's technical capabilities.
Adaptability and ecosystem growth make this platform particularly interesting for future development.
Arbitrum (ARB)
As a Layer 2 scaling solution for Ethereum, Arbitrum enhances transaction speeds while reducing fees through roll-up technology. Its compatibility with Ethereum Virtual Machine allows seamless integration with existing applications. The solution addresses network congestion issues while maintaining security standards.
Upcoming protocol upgrades aim to further improve performance and cost efficiency.

Hedera (HBAR)
Employing hashgraph consensus rather than traditional blockchain, Hedera achieves high-speed transaction processing with low latency. The platform supports diverse use cases including tokenization and enterprise solutions. Governance through established organizations provides additional credibility and security.
Industry partnerships and institutional backing contribute to network development.

How reliable are meme coins as investment vehicles?
Meme coins typically derive value from community sentiment rather than fundamental utility, making them highly volatile. While some have developed additional functionality, they generally carry higher risk than projects with established use cases.

Can Layer 2 solutions outperform base layer blockchains?
Layer 2 solutions often provide enhanced scalability and efficiency while leveraging the security of underlying blockchains. Their performance advantages make them competitive for specific use cases, though base layers continue to develop their own scaling solutions.
